#bd150f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bd150f is composed of 74.1% red, 8.2%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.9% magenta, 92.1%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 2.1 degrees, a saturation of 85.3% and a lightness of 40%. #bd150f color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2a1e with #7b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

#bd150f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bd150f has RGB values of R:189, G:21,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.89, Y:0.92,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 12391695.

Shades and Tints of #bd150f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070101 is the darkest color, while #fef4f4 is the lightest one.
